The emotional core of the film is Hemel’s relationship with her father, Gijs. Following the death of her mother, the two have formed a bond that is both tender and stiflingly close. This equilibrium is shattered when Gijs begins a serious relationship with Sophie. Hemel’s subsequent spiral into increasingly risky behavior highlights her fear of abandonment; for her, Gijs represents the only stable source of affection, and his moving on feels like a personal erasure. Hemel’s character is defined by a paradox: she is physically intimate with many but emotionally connected to few. Her frequent sexual escapades with strangers serve as a mechanism to test the limits of physical sensation while simultaneously insulating herself from true vulnerability. Polak uses these encounters not to sensationalize, but to illustrate Hemel’s desperate, often misguided, attempt to find where sex ends and love begins. The Father-Daughter Dynamic
